Fitting Accusump to zx12r Help
I am fitting a accusump to a zx12r engine,
Has anyone done this or could they advise the best gallery to install it in.??
preferably a 1/2 inch gallery, i can only see one on the block + the oil pressure gallery. these look too small??
any advise greatly appreciated.

Sean,
the blanking plug that goes directly into the main oil gallery (Opposite the OEM pressure sender) is 5/8" or roughly 16mm, so should be plenty
big enough. Looks like this is also the best place to install the accusump - directly into the main gallery. Don't take my word for it though.
It's real tight to get the hex plug out though and you'll need a length of tube on your allen key for leverage to remove it.
